Hotel Review of the
Executive Inn At Whistler Village
Feb 23, 2011
We chose this hotel on the basis that it was the cheapest deal for a decent
central hotel in Whistler when we booked and we decided that we didn't need
extra facilities such as a pool or sauna (the hotel has no common areas to speak
of and a small reception area). I can't talk about value as with the current £
exchange rate everything in Whistler seems very expensive! We were broadly happy
with our choice primarily due to the price but felt we might have been better
off at the Adara which was our other option. We were in a queen loft suite on
the fourth floor and found the room fine if quite dark decor and oddly shaped -
with limited space to put things - which gave it a poky feeling. There is a fire
but you have to pay $5 for a log downstairs to use it. The AC/heater is quite
noisy but we switched it off at night. Our main gripe was with the sleeping
arrangements. The bed was on a mezzanine level under the slanting roof. It makes
the room a bit different from the standard, but we found that on one side of the
bed you can't sit up without banging your head on the beam and on the other you
have to clamber over the bed to go downstairs. The pillows were absolutely
terrible - these were thick hard foam which were uncomfortable enough for us to
ditch them altogether - which didn't make for the most comfortable nights'
sleep. The bed also rolled/had a dip in the middle. Pros were the bathroom
which, while compact, was modern and clean with a sizeable and powerful walk-in
shower. Also the location right on the main stroll opposite the Hilton and about
a minute from the ski lifts (although most of the main hotels seem to be within
1-2m range of the lifts). We weren't disturbed by any noise at night although
our room was on the stroll side. Overall, I probably wouldn't stay here again
unless there was a really good deal available.

Hotel Review of the
Executive Inn At Whistler Village
Feb 14, 2011
We stayed 5 nights and I was expecting a boutique-like little hotel with small
rooms. There aren't any real boutique touches and I felt like the photos I had
looked at online were overly flattering given the reality. Rooms are small but
not unreasonable except for the bathroom where you had to close the door if you
wanted to access the countertop. Location was ideal for getting to the lifts but
it was noisy on the stroll til well after midnight all nights. I had looked
forward to the woodburning fireplace but there's no wood - just $5 firelogs so
it's not so easy to have a little 1 hour fire and no crackling and nice wood
smells. Nothing sumptuous about the bathrobes, nothing contemporary about the
kitchenette, don't remember any wood in the bathroom although the countertop is
marble. We also had trouble on the financial end - our credit card was
overbilled by hundreds of dollars by accident which they did correct when we
pointed it out. We also reserved in advance so when a special deal later came up
they didn't honour the new price - they did upgrade our room and give us a
discount but it was nowhere close to the deal we would have got if we booked
last minute.
